Are Online Casinos Legal in Florida?
Real money online casinos are NOT legal in Florida. In fact, as it currently stands, online casino gambling is allowed in just 7 of the 50 U.S. states (CT, DE, MI, NJ, PA, RI, & WV). And, sorry to be the bearer of bad news, but it doesn’t look like Florida will be legalizing online casinos anytime soon.
Florida Sweepstakes Casinos
Although real money online casinos aren’t available in Florida, there is a 100% safe and legal alternative: sweepstakes casinos. These sites operate legally by having players use virtual currencies (Gold Coins and Sweeps Coins) instead of real money for wagering on games.
Sweepstakes casinos, like the ones we talked about in the previous section, are your best bet if you’d like to play online casino games in the Sunshine State.
However, it is important to note that (in order to comply with Florida’s sweepstakes laws) most sweepstakes casinos will set a cap on how much FL players can win on any given spin or hand, typically around $5,000.

Latest FL Gambling News: A Timeline of Events
- February 2025: The FGCC issues cease-and-desist orders to the parent companies of BetUS, Bovada, and MyBookie. The commission is demanding that these offshore gambling sites immediately stop offering online casino games and sports betting to Floridians.
- July 2024: 11 illegal brick-and-mortar casinos are shut down near Daytona, according to the Volusia County Sheriff’s Office. Agents from the Florida Gaming Control Commission (FGCC) assisted with the investigation.
- January 2024: Florida Senator Travis Hutson introduces a bill that would create the framework for regulating daily fantasy sports (DFS) in the Sunshine State.
- December 2023: Seminole casinos in Florida begin offering craps and roulette, according to NBC6 South Florida. The change comes as part of the 2021 Gaming Compact, an agreement between Governor Ron DeSantis and Seminole Tribe Chairman Marcellus Osceola Jr.

If you’re a new online casino player (or you just typically don’t bother with the promotions they offer), that’s okay! I’ve provided a quick breakdown of the different bonus opportunities commonly provided to new and existing users:
No Deposit Bonus
Florida no-deposit bonuses are free rewards you get just for signing up, no deposit required. For example, a casino might give you $25 in bonus funds or 50 free spins right away. All you have to do is create an account and complete the quick verification process.
Deposit Match
Deposit matches are also pretty common at FL online casinos. With these, the casino will match a percentage of your deposit with bonus money. Let’s say a site offers a 100% deposit match up to $500. Then, depositing $500 would double your bankroll and give you an extra $500 to play with.
Cashback Offers
Cashback deals (also called “Rakeback” or “Play It Again” promotions) involve a percentage of your losses being returned to you as bonus money. For example, a casino might offer 50% cashback on any net losses from the previous day. So, if you lose $100, you’d get $50 back.
Refer A Friend
Next, when you successfully convince a friend to sign up, you’ll typically earn a “Refer A Friend” bonus. For instance, if a casino offers a $50 referral bonus, you would get $50 automatically when your friend joins and deposits a certain amount of money.
VIP Rewards
Lastly, loyal online casino players (high rollers, in particular) can earn special perks like exclusive bonuses, faster withdrawals, or even real-life rewards. Most gambling sites use a multi-tiered rewards system, and you can climb the ranks by wagering more money on games.

Should You Play at Offshore Casinos in FL?
Have you ever heard of sites like Bovada, BetUS, and MyBookie? These are commonly referred to as “offshore casinos” because they operate outside the U.S. in places where online gambling laws are much more relaxed.
You can technically choose to sign up, play games, and wager real money at offshore casinos…but I’d strongly advise against it for a number of reasons.
First, they aren’t licensed or regulated by the Florida Gaming Control Commission (or any other U.S. gaming authorities), which leaves you with no guarantee of fair play or safe transactions.
Plus, most people see the 100%, 150%, or even 200% deposit matches that offshore casinos offer to new players as a huge advantage. Well, I completely disagree. These sign-up bonuses always come with ridiculous playthrough requirements (e.g., 35x or 40x), making it next to impossible to actually cash out any winnings.
As a result, I’d recommend that Florida players avoid offshore casino sites altogether. Instead, stick to licensed and regulated alternatives, like legal sweepstakes casinos or local casinos that offer a safe in-person gambling experience.

Florida Land-Based Casinos: A Quick Overview
If you ever want to switch things up and play games in person (rather than online), then you’re in luck. Florida is home to plenty of tribal casinos, racinos, and casino cruises.
Let’s take a quick look at some of the most popular Florida casinos and what they have to offer:

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ood
- 📍 Address: 1 Seminole Way, Hollywood, FL 33314
- 📞 Phone Number: (866) 502-7529
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ood is one of South Florida’s premier entertainment destinations. The casino resort is owned by the Seminole Tribe of Florida, and it includes 2,700 slot machines, nearly 200 table games, and a 45-table poker room.
Plus, the casino offers plenty of betting options to suit every player’s budget. You can wager anywhere from $0.01 to $5.00 on the main floor, and in the High Limit Slots room, you can do $1.00 to $1,000 per spin.

Calder Casino
- 📍 Address: 21001 NW 27th Ave, Miami Gardens, FL 33056
- 📞 Phone Number: (305) 625-1311
Calder Casino is another popular casino in South Florida. The facility offers 1,100 of the latest and great slot machines (Royal Reels, Dragon Link, Player’s Paradise, etc.) as well as electronic table games, live table game action, and live card games like Ultimate Texas Hold ‘Em, Three Card Poker, and DJ Wild Stud Poker.

Miccosukee Casino & Resort
- 📍 Address: 500 SW 177th Ave, Miami, FL 33194
- 📞 Phone Number: (305) 925-2555
The Miccosukee Casino & Resort is branded as the “ultimate destination for gaming, entertainment, and leisure in the heart of the Everglades.”
Owned by the Miccosukee Tribe of Indians of Florida, this luxurious casino resort offers 1,800+ slot machines (including both single-game slots and multi-game machines), a 20-table poker room, and bingo games Wednesday through Friday.
